    Have a copy of all your bills in front of you with the account numbers, addresses and phone numbers.
    Then go to your banks website.
    Sign in to your account.
    Follow the steps listed on the banks site for pay on line access.

    Or, go to each individual bill’s website, and set up an account with each one.

    Remember to set a good password that can’t be cracked easily.
    for example, make up a sentence: 6 Year old had a party in my barn + a Case of beer.
    It would be: 6Yohapimb+aCob
    Very difficult to crack.
